In 2000 Michelle Danner founded Edgemar Center for the Arts, a two theatre and art gallery complex. The Larry Moss Studio has been housed at Edgemar since the cutting of the ribbon in 2002 and has flourished and grown into what is now the Acting Studio at Edgemar. The complex is a stop on the tour of local gems in Santa Monica designed by architect Frank Gehry.
The Acting Studio at Edgemar is the heart & the foundation of Edgemar Center for the Arts that gives birth to professional & classical theater productions, dance performances, visual arts & films festivals.
